It's a tube screamer. Simple. Useful.

I was previously using a BBE Green Screamer, a discontinued clone of TS808, and I had no issue with it; but the pedal enclosure is bigger than a typical MXR size and I was running out of space on my board, so I decided to get the Maxon OD808. From what I've researched the Maxon is actually closer to the Ibanez TS10 spec-wise. I have no idea if the Maxon does sound like an Ibanez TS10, but I do know that compared to the BBE the Maxon is slightly warmer. Noise level is about the same: minimal. The BBE features true bypass, while the Maxon has a buffered bypass, but from what I can tell the buffered bypass does not seem to add brightness which I've noticed with other buffered bypass pedals. Overall, I'm satisfied and I would recommend the Maxon to others looking for a tube screamer without a boutique price tag.Read full review...

Maxon OD808 is my first real overdrive. good value!

This overdrive can be described as clean, has nice tone, and is great value for an over 100 dollar overdrive pedal. The sound has lots of mids and sounds controlled. I usually used a boss super overdrive and this one sounds quite similar. It just sounds cleaner. less hair in the midrange and top end. It's also less bright. This is good for pushing a distortion pedal or amp into high gain. The midrange has punch and sounds like it has nice quality going for it. Read full review...
